Not a "camping" resort but more like a temporary home in a gated community. Spaces are individually owned and controlled by an HOA so there are many rules. Pricey but that's what you pay for an upscale resort like this, we paid $350 including our Good Sam discount for 2 nights but had a spectacular site with an ocean and lighthouse view. The beach is a bit of a hike down the hill but beautiful, wide, sandy beach awaits that you could walk for miles! Nothing within walking distance for food, but Newport is only a few miles away by car, bike, taxi.

We weren’t disappointed this place is amazing. All the amenities are what you would expect, very clean, the spots are large, there are hiking trails down to a beautiful private beach. I would spend the extra money to get a beachfront lighthouse view site I think space 141 is the best in the park. The front desk people were great
